COMPANY OFFERS 22 VACANCIES FOR DIFFERENT WORK AREAS, AND APPLICATIONS WILL BE AVAILABLE UNTIL MAY 25TH

 Pirelli launches another edition of its traditional internship program. With the motto Join the movement: Develop your potential, O Pirelli Internship Program 2025.2 offers 22 new vacancies, for more than ten areas of the company. Applications must be made by official website of the program and will be open from April 15 to May 25 of this year. People approved in the process will start their new jobs from July 21, 2025.

The job vacancies will be for the following areas: Health, Safety and Environment; Supply Chain, Logistics, Purchasing and Supplies; IT; Engineering; Quality; Laboratory, R&D and Projects; Marketing, Commercial, Sales and Business; Financial, Accounting, Economics and Controllership; Administrative, Backoffice

The jobs will be for six of the company's work units: Feira de Santana, Barueri, Cabreúva, Campinas, São Bernardo and São Paulo.

After registration, the next stages of the selection process are: screening, online group dynamics, business panel and interviews with Pirelli management. 

PIRELLI INTERNSHIP PROGRAM 2025.2

Registration period: April 15th to May 25th

Registration and more informationhttps://estagiopirelli.com.br

Number of vacancies: 22

Start of internship: July 21st of 2025

Workload: 6 hours per day

Grant Aid: Higher education between R$ 1,189.44 and R$ 1,869.84 (varies by location); Technical education between R$ 756.00 and R$ 1,198.26 (varies by location).

Benefits: Medical assistance; meal vouchers or on-site cafeteria (varies by location); transportation vouchers (R$$170.00 to R$$260.00) and/or chartered buses (varies by location); recess – 15 days every 6 months; Christmas basket; life insurance; Discount PitStop (series of special discounts in various segments of physical and virtual stores, such as restaurants, travel, among others); 30% discount on tires; WellHub (formerly Gympass); Plenamente Program – mental health support, Sempre Bem (monitoring of people with chronic diseases and subsidy of medication for the following diseases: hypertension; diabetes; lung diseases; cardiovascular diseases).
